Kolatu was born an only child in a small village in a thick forest full of inhabitants from several races, but he has no recollection of where exactly it was. His parents were farmers and didn't make much money but there life was rich with love, focusing all their care and attention on their one child. His early life was great, he was kept fed and well looked after until around age 5 when his family began to move to avoid an incoming disease. He doesn't know much about the disease, only remembering his Father's repeated plea to his mother to move south, but he survived long enough to reach a small village in western Aegrothond before his travelled, ageing, weak parents began showing signs of sickness. Kolatu understands that his parents died shortly after their arrival and he was taken in by local caring Wood Elves who kept him clothed and fed, often telling him he was a special child and a beam of hope for an otherwise ordinary village. The locals who raised him believe he is special for avoiding the disease that killed his parents, but Kolatu believes he was just lucky. He often wonders if he used all of his luck avoiding the disease and doesn't have any left. When he was 15, the locals decided that having lived there for a decade, he should pull his weight, so they assigned him to look after the animals of the village when their owners were out hunting or foraging. Having met very few people in his formative years and having very little experience doing anything, he became obsessed with the idea that he was a dull, boring soul with no purpose in life. Upon turning 18, Kolatu decided it was time to kick his pessimistic thoughts aside and focus on his adventurous ambition to do something big with his life. Armed with a desire to learn and explore and very little else, he asked the locals to send him in the direction of the nearest city.
